thermal: qcom-spmi: Treat reg property as a single cell
We only read the first element of the reg property to figure out the offset of the temperature sensor inside the PMIC. Furthermore, we want to remove the second element in DT, so just don't read the second element so that probe keeps working if we change the DT in the future. Cc: Ivan T.
